Bolton College, with a £27 million turnover, is part of the University of Bolton Group and is an Ofsted-rated 'Good' provider. We work with over 600 employers in Greater Manchester, delivering vocational training from our £75 million campus in Bolton town centre. We have decades of experience in apprenticeships, delivering over 40 programmes across 20 industry sectors, helping employers to improve productivity and create a skilled future workforce. Employ an apprentice with us, and an experienced Account Manager, Assessor and subject area Tutor will support you throughout. All apprenticeships are delivered in industry-standard facilities, with clear progression pathways to employment and higher education.
